Metal grease filter - DU 4360/4161/4361/4561

• The purpose of the grease filters is to absorb grease particles which

form during cooking and it must always be used, either in the

external extraction or internal re-circulation function.

Attention: the metal grease filters must be removed and washed,

either by hand or in the dishwasher, every four weeks.

Removing the metal grease filter

First pull the latches backwards (a), then extract the grille outwards

(b). Fig. 4.

Hand washing

Soak grease filters for about one hour in hot water with a grease-

loosening cleaner, then rinse off thoroughly with hot water. Repeat the

process if necessary. Refit the grease filters when they are dry.

Dishwasher

Place grease filters in the dishwasher. Select most powerful washing

programme and highest temperature, at least 65°C. Repeat the

process. Refit the grease filters when they are dry.

When washing the metal grease filter in the dishwasher a slight

discolouration of the filter can occur, this does not have any impact

on its performance.

• Clean the inner housing using a hand hot solution only(never use

caustic detergents, abrasive powders or brushes).
